Lancaster Gate tube station

Lancaster Gate is an underground station of the London Underground in the City of Westminster. It lies on the northern edge of Hyde Park on Bayswater Road in Bayswater area. The area served by the Central Line and located in the Travelcard Zone 1 station was used in 2011 of 6.68 million passengers.

The opening took place on July 30, 1900 by the Central London Railway, the predecessor of the Central Line. The original station building was from Harry Bell Measures, it was demolished in 1968 and replaced by a modern building of the architectural firm TP Bennett & Son, originally housed offices, but is now used by a hotel.

From July 3 to November 13, 2006, the station was closed to allow a modernization of the old elevators. During the work we renovated the rest of the station and provided them with improved video surveillance. Paddington Station is located about five minutes walk away.
